The sources of A Course in Miracles could be traced back again to the relationship between two individuals, Helen Schucman and Bill Thetford, equally of whom were prominent psychologists and researchers. The course's inception happened in early 1960s when Schucman, who was simply a clinical and study psychiatrist at Columbia University's College of Physicians and Surgeons, began to experience some inner dictations. She described these dictations as originating from an internal style that recognized it self as Jesus Christ. Schucman originally resisted these experiences, but with Thetford's support, she started transcribing the communications she received.

Over a period of seven decades, Schucman transcribed what might become A Program in Miracles, amounting to three volumes: the Text, the Book for Pupils, and the Manual for Teachers. The Text lays out the theoretical basis of the program, elaborating on the core methods and principles. The Workbook for Pupils contains 365 lessons, one for every day of the season, made to steer the reader through a everyday exercise of applying the course's teachings. The Manual for Educators gives further guidance on how best to realize and train the maxims of A Class in Miracles to others.
